Microsoft is heavily invested in the future of AI agents, showcasing significant advancements at Microsoft Build 2025. The company envisions an "age of AI agents" where systems proactively assist users, spotting problems and suggesting solutions independently. This shift moves beyond simple request-response interactions to a more dynamic and helpful AI experience. To support this evolution, Microsoft is focusing on adapting and enhancing existing identity standards, particularly OAuth, to manage how these agents access data and operate across diverse connected systems, spanning from APIs to sensitive business processes.
Microsoft is introducing Microsoft Entra Agent ID, extending its identity management and access capabilities to AI agents. This is a crucial step towards securing the "agentic workforce." Furthermore, the company has already launched a public preview of the Conditional Access Optimizer Agent, a multi-functional AI agent capable of analyzing Conditional Access policies, identifying security gaps, and deploying new policies in pilot mode. Similar investments are being made in agents for developer and operations workflows, such as SWE and SRE agents, designed to boost productivity for teams involved in application development and maintenance.
Microsoft emphasizes that the industry needs to continue collaborating on establishing identity standards for agent access across various systems. The developments reflect Microsoft's commitment to building a robust and sophisticated suite of agents designed to augment and amplify organizational capabilities. Ultimately, Microsoft envisions these AI agents as integral components of an open agentic web, which requires a strong foundation of Zero Trust security principles.
